This document specifies the methods of preparation of test specimens and the test methods to be used in determining the properties of PVC-U moulding and extrusion materials. Requirements for handling test materials and for conditioning both the test material before moulding and the specimens before testing are given. The properties required for the designation of PVC-U thermoplastics are given in ISO 21306-1. All properties are intended to be determined by the appropriate methods referred to in this document and values obtained shall be presented as laid down in ISO 10350-1. The values determined in accordance with this document are not necessarily be identical to those obtained using specimens of different dimensions and/or prepared by different procedures. The values obtained for the properties of a moulding depend on the moulding compound, the shape, the test method and the state of anisotropy. The last-mentioned depends on the gating of the mould and the moulding conditions, for example temperature, pressure and injection rate. Any subsequent treatment is also be considered, for example conditioning or annealing. The thermal history and the internal stresses of the specimens can strongly influence the thermal and mechanical properties and the resistance to environmental stress cracking, but exert less effect on the electrical properties, which depend mainly on the chemical composition of the moulding compound. In order to obtain reproducible and comparable test results, the methods of preparation and conditioning, the specimen dimensions and the test procedures specified herein are used. Values determined are not necessarily be identical to those obtained using specimens of different dimensions or prepared using different procedures.
Abstract
Overview
ISO 21306-2:2019 - Plastics - Unplasticized poly(vinyl chloride) (PVC‑U) moulding and extrusion materials - Part 2 - specifies how to prepare test specimens and determine the physical, thermal, mechanical and electrical properties of PVC‑U materials for moulding and extrusion. It defines handling, pre‑treatment, specimen preparation (compression moulding and machining/punching) and conditioning to ensure reproducible, comparable test results. Test data are to be reported in accordance with ISO 10350‑1 and material designation follows ISO 21306‑1.
Key topics and requirements
- Specimen preparation
- Pre‑plasticization on a two‑roll mill and production of compression‑moulded plates (conditions given in the standard).
- Machining or punching of specimens from compression plates per ISO 2818.
- Use of the code letter “Q” to indicate compression‑moulded specimens.
- Conditioning
- Standard conditioning at 23 °C ± 2 °C and 50 % ± 5 % RH for at least 16 hours; a minimum of 24 hours is recommended before electrical tests.
- Emphasis on controlling thermal history and internal stress because these affect mechanical, thermal and environmental stress‑cracking behaviour.
- Test methods and presentation
- Mechanical: tensile (ISO 527 series), flexural (ISO 178), impact Charpy (ISO 179), tensile‑impact (ISO 8256), creep (ISO 899‑1).
- Thermal: heat‑deflection (ISO 75‑1/2), Vicat softening (ISO 306), flammability/oxygen index (IEC 60695‑11‑10, ISO 4589).
- Electrical: permittivity (IEC 60250), resistivity (IEC 62631‑3‑1/3‑2), dielectric strength (IEC 60243‑1).
- Test conditions, specimen dimensions and reporting formats are specified (refer to the tabulated test matrix in the standard).
Practical applications
- Ensures reproducible comparative data for material suppliers, compounders and product designers working with PVC‑U for injection moulding and extrusion.
- Supports material specification, quality control and product development by providing standardized procedures for:
- Selecting PVC‑U grades for pipes, window profiles, fittings, housings and electrical insulation components.
- Evaluating mechanical strength, stiffness, impact resistance, thermal performance and electrical insulation properties.
- Generating intrinsic material data for data sheets and regulatory or procurement specifications.
Who should use this standard
- Material manufacturers and compound formulators producing PVC‑U.
- Test laboratories performing standardized physical, thermal and electrical testing.
- Product designers, specifiers, certification bodies and quality engineers requiring comparable material property data.
